RusForest to Release 2Q Report on 31 August
OREANDA-NEWS. August 22, 2012. RusForest AB, a Swedish forestry company with operations in Russia, will release its second quarter 2012 report on 31 August 2012 before market open. A telephone conference will be held the same day at 14:00 Central European Time (CET).
RusForest is a publicly-traded Swedish forestry company operating in eastern Siberia and the Arkhangelsk region of Russia. The Company controls approximately 3 million hectares of timber through long-term leases with an annual allowable cut (“AAC”) of approximately 3.6 million cubic meters.
RusForest owns five sawmills in close proximity to its forest leases and is self-sufficient in raw material to produce more than 400,000 cubic meters per year of sawnwood products.
RusForest is listed on NASDAQ OMX Stockholm First North (ticker symbol “RUSF”). RusForest’s largest shareholder is Vostok Nafta Investment Ltd, which owns approximately 29 per cent of the Company’s shares.
